Background Info

Weather
Ageo Shi experiences mild to hot summers with temperatures ranging from 20°C to 30°C and high humidity. Winters are cold, with temperatures dropping to around 0°C. Rainfall is evenly distributed throughout the year, with occasional snowfall in winter. Air quality is generally good in this region.

Language
Japanese is the primary language spoken in Ageo Shi, although English is also used in tourist areas.

Cost Of Living
The cost of living in Ageo Shi is moderate compared to other cities in Japan. Rent, groceries, and transportation costs are reasonably affordable, making it an attractive place to live.

Ageo – city in Saitama Prefecture, Japan

Post Codes: 362-8501

Official Names: 上尾市 (Japanese)


Population: 227,127

Elevation: 14 m

Area: 45.51 sq km

Coordinates: 35.977, 139.593

Timezone: (UTC+09:00) Japan Standard Time (Tokyo)
